The water in my Downtown Lake Zurich basement is gone and the surface feels dry, but I'm told it's still 'wet' by your standards. Why?
A surface feeling 'dry to the touch' is a sensory illusion. True dryness is defined by the psychrometric standard of 40 Grains Per Pound (GPP) of dry air at 70°F. This measures the vapor pressure of moisture trapped within building materials. In your neighborhood's humid microclimate, failing to dry to this standard leaves residual vapor pressure that will migrate and cause secondary damage, violating the IICRC S500 standard of care.

My insurer called my kitchen overflow 'Category 2 Grey Water.' What does that mean, and can I lower my premiums?
Category 2 water contains significant contamination (e.g., from appliances, cleaning agents) and requires specific biocidal treatment. It is distinct from 'Clean' (Category 1) or sewage 'Black' (Category 3) water. Illinois insurers now offer a 5-8% premium credit for homes with IoT leak sensors like Moen Flo. These devices provide instant alerts and automatic shut-off, dramatically reducing the severity and cost of a claim.
